#cb6c73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b6c73 is composed of 79.6% red, 42.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 355.6 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 61%. #cb6c73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8e6 with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#cb6c73 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cb6c73 has RGB values of R:203, G:108,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.43,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13331571.

Hex triplet cb6c73 #cb6c73
RGB Decimal 203, 108, 115 rgb(203,108,115)
RGB Percent 79.6, 42.4, 45.1 rgb(79.6%,42.4%,45.1%)
CMYK 0, 47, 43, 20
HSL 355.6°, 47.7, 61 hsl(355.6,47.7%,61%)
HSV (or HSB) 355.6°, 46.8, 79.6
Web Safe cc6666 #cc6666
CIE-LAB 56.745, 38.173, 13.198
XYZ 33.086, 24.662, 19.236
xyY 0.43, 0.32, 24.662
CIE-LCH 56.745, 40.39, 19.072
CIE-LUV 56.745, 65.959, 9.9
Hunter-Lab 49.661, 32.018, 11.796
Binary 11001011, 01101100, 01110011

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#cb6c73 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#898989 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#968385 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#928d86 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a48974 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cd737b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a7817f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b27e74 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#cc7078 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
